The anisotropic surface diffusion with elasticity in three dimensions via the Cahn-Taylor minimizing movement scheme
Abstract
In this paper, we introduce a suitable notion of flat solutions for the anisotropic surface diffusion equation with elasticity in three-dimensions, based on a minimizing movement scheme inspired by that introduced by Cahn and Taylor. Using this scheme, we prove the existence of classical solutions to the equation without using a curvature regularization term. Moreover we establish the consistency of the approximation method.
